What Makes Correx Signs Perfect for Christmas Markets?
Correx, sometimes known as corrugated plastic, is a material that effortlessly combines lightness with resilience. It’s a common choice for temporary outdoor signage, and it’s easy to see why. You’ll spot Correx signs in all sorts of settings, from sports events to elections, but they seem particularly suited to the festive environment of Christmas markets. Here’s a closer look at the qualities that make Correx the go-to option:
- Weather-resistant: December weather in the UK can be notoriously unpredictable—rain, frost, biting winds. Correx signs are tough enough to withstand these conditions without looking worse for wear. They won’t warp or fade quickly, meaning they stay legible throughout the market’s run.
- Light and easy to handle: Unlike heavier materials like metal or wood, Correx boards are easy to carry and reposition. This flexibility is handy when layouts change or when quick adjustments are needed, especially in busy market environments.
- Cost-effective: Budgets for Christmas markets can be tight, and Correx offers a wallet-friendly signage solution without sacrificing visibility or clarity. It allows organisers to cover multiple locations without breaking the bank.
- Customisable: You can print bright, eye-catching designs on Correx that not only direct visitors but add to the festive atmosphere. Whether it’s bold arrows, seasonal motifs, or branded logos, the material takes print well.
Top Tips for Using Correx Signs at Your Christmas Market
Simply putting up a sign doesn’t guarantee visitors will find their way. To make the most of Correx signage, a bit of thought goes a long way. Here are some down-to-earth tips that can help signs do their job properly:
- Keep it clear and simple: Big, bold fonts and straightforward wording are your friends. Avoid cluttered messages. Words like “Entrance,” “Food Court,” or “Santa’s Grotto” are instantly understandable, even to those who might be distracted by the festive buzz.
- Think about placement: Signs should appear exactly where people need guidance—at crossroads, near entrances, or just before popular stalls. If a visitor has to stop and guess where to go, the sign isn’t doing its job.
- Use bright colours and festive graphics: This does more than catch the eye. It helps the signage feel like part of the celebration rather than an afterthought. Think reds, greens, and golds, decorated with holly or snowflakes.
- Secure your signs properly: Wind gusts can turn a helpful sign into a fluttering nuisance. Use stakes, zip ties, or weighted bases to keep Correx boards firmly in place. This also prevents potential hazards from loose signage.
- Consider double-sided printing: Markets tend to have visitors coming from all directions. Double-sided signs ensure that no matter which way someone is approaching from, the message is clear.
- Plan for accessibility: A sign that’s too high, too low, or angled awkwardly can exclude some visitors. Make sure signs are positioned where everyone, including those using wheelchairs or walking aids, can see and read them comfortably.
